Spain residence permit for Non-EU
citizens
International investors can now gain a
residency
visa for Spain
through the purchase of Spanish
property. The visa
is available to anyone investing a minimum
of 500,000 Euros in property.
A family or a person from a Non-EU country can as investor get a
Spanish residency
Golden Visa through the purchase
of a property
or properties in Spain
.
Residency in Spain is granted under the new investor visa for
investors spending a minimum of 500,000 Euros on a Real Estate
property purchase. Residency means the right to live in Spain and
travel freely to Spain which is within the Schengen visa area of
Europe. It does not grant citizenship, which can be applied for at a
later date. Citizenship in Spain can lead to residency in other
European countries.
Residency in Spain under the golden investor visa program allows a Real Estate investor and his or her immediate family to live in
Spain. The legislation has no minimum period of residence. Hence an
investor can buy a property in Spain, travel freely to Spain at any
point and his or her family can do the same. The family can live in
Spain
permanently, with access to schools both state and private
following the English curriculum. Eventually citizenship can grant
access to study elsewhere at universities in Europe including the UK.
ESSENTIAL RULES OF SPANISH INVESTMENT VISA:
The minimum investment must be at
500,000€.
On top of the amount of investment
you need to add 11 - 12%, which goes to the purchase cost, including
tax, stamp duty, VAT, notary and lawyer.
Investments may be spread over
several properties for a total purchase price of at least 500,000€.
Spanish residence visas may be
issued to the immediate family, including spouse and children up to
18 years.
There is no requirement for
minimum stays ordering to renew the visa. This means that it is
optional to stay in Spain.
The Spanish visa does not need to
be renewed within five years.
As there is no law on minimum stay
is not necessary to be tax resident.
Permanent residence can be granted
after five years if you have followed the rules.
Your property investment can be
sold after five years when you have achieved permanent residency.
The visa allows access to
unlimited travel throughout the EU Schengen visa countries.
The entire application procedure
for investment visa applicants will not take more than twenty days.
Investments must be documented
before applying for Spanish investment visa.
Refusal of Spanish investment visa
will usually only be justified by an unclean criminal record.
Spanish citizenship can
be given after an additional five years of permanent residency.
The applicant must be able to
prove that having traveled to Spain at least once in the first two
years, and once more in the three subsequent years.
While a Spanish citizen you
automatically get an European citizenship.
After this time (2 x 5 years), the
family can live, work or study anywhere in Europe within the EU.

THE APPLICANT MUST MEET THE FOLLOWING
REQUIREMENTS:
Not to have entered or stayed
illegally in Spanish territory.
Have to be 18 years or over.
Not to have been refused entry in
any of the Schengen countries.
Have public or private health
insurance authorized to operate in Spain.
Have sufficient economic means to
cover personal and family living expenses.
- Proof of the investment must be made through a Registry of
Property certificate attesting ownership. Or, if the ownership title
is not yet registered, via a copy of the acquisition public deed and
proof of filing the deed in the Registry.
RESIDENCE VISA FOR INVESTORS (YEAR 1)
First you get an ordinary 90-day visa so you can come to
Spain to search for property, and once in Spain you sign a power of
attorney giving your lawyer power to act on your behalf in
the conveyancing and residency process.
However, if you don’t have time to come to Spain, and you have
found a property that you are prepared to buy without visiting, you
can organize a power of attorney from your home country (this is not
possible from all countries) giving your lawyer power to act on your
behalf in the conveyancing and residency process. Your lawyer can
then buy the property on your behalf, so you don’t even have to
come to Spain at this stage.
One you have bought a property that meets the investment criteria
(more than €500,000 on the deeds), you need to apply for a one-year
investor visa, which allows you to spend a year in Spain, and travel
freely in the Schengen area for 90 days out of every 180 days. Your
lawyer can obtain this for you.
Once you have obtained this visa, you are not obliged to spend a
minimum amount of time in Spain during the year. However, to get the
residency permit at the end of the year, you do have to visit Spain
at least once in the year. So, do not apply for the one-year investor
visa until you are sure that you will be coming to Spain in the next
12 months.
This one-year investor visa will be authorized in Diplomatic
Missions and Consular Spanish Offices and can be issued for one, two
or multiple entries into Spain.
These visa applications shall be processed and notification sent
within 10 working days, except in case of applicants subject to prior
consultation.
RESIDENCE AUTHORIZATION FOR INVESTORS (YEARS 2 TO
5 OR MORE)
Once an investment has been made, and after the first year,
investors can apply for authorization to live in Spain for two years,
renewable for another two years after that (and on), so long as the
investment threshold of €500,000 is maintained (see below). For
this application you have to be show that you have travelled to Spain
at least once in the previous 12 months.
There is no limit to the amount of times this two-year residency
can be renewed.
Properties can be bought and sold during this period, so long as
the investment threshold is maintained.
There is no obligation to spend a minimum amount of time in Spain,
so investors can remain tax resident outside of Spain, whilst
benefiting from Spanish residency and the freedom of unlimited travel
and stays in the EU.
Processing and granting the residence will be done by the Spanish
Ministry of Foreign Affairs.
Applications will be responded to within 20 working days from the
submission of the application. If there is no answer in this period,
the application shall be considered as accepted. The formal answer to
the application can take up to 6 months, but in theory the
application is considered accepted if there is no answer in 20 days.
LONG-TERM RESIDENCE AND SPANISH NATIONALITY (YEAR
5 ONWARDS, OPTIONAL)
After five years of continuous residence, investors can apply for
permanent residence in Spain.
Likewise, after ten years of residence, Spanish nationality can be
requested. In such cases, an effective justification of at least six
months of residence must be provided, (unless due cause exists).
PROPERTY INVESTMENT - INVESTMENT THRESHOLD
The investment threshold for real estate is €500,000 or more per
investor.
To apply for residency, proof of the investment(s) must be
provided with a Property Registry filing (certificate). If this
certificate is not yet available, then the notarized deeds and proof
that the deeds have been submitted to the Property Registry must be
provided.
The investment can be comprised of:
One or several properties.
Of a residential, touristic,
rural, commercial or industrial nature
- Rural land, developed land, buildings under construction, or
decrepit buildings
FINANCING
Investors must use at least €500,000 of their own funds, which
must come from transparent sources that comply with existing
legislation on money laundering and so on. Above that threshold there
is no limit to debt financing, for instance with a mortgage in Spain.
